Obituary for Enns


Published in the Albuquerque Journal on Sunday January 30, 2000

Karl C. Enns, 94, born in Inman, Kansas on October 9, 1905 to Dick and Millicent Enns, died Wednesday, January 26, 2000. Mr. Enns moved to Albuquerque in 1950. He is survived by his wife, Nettie Darrah whom he married on June 20, 1930; his son, Jack D. Enns and wife, Katherine of Albuquerque; daughter, Janet E. Alexander and husband, Dick of Holbrook, AZ; six grandchildren, Karl David Enns, Beth Enns, Joyce Selfridge, all of Albuquerque, Ted Alexander of Phoenix, Douglas Alexander of Tempe, AZ and Scott Alexander of Phoenix, AZ; and five great-grandchildren, Johannah Alexander of Tempe, AZ, Charlotte Selfridge, Naomi Selfridge, Julie Selfridge and Dustin Enns, all of Albuquerque. Mr. Enns was preceded in death by his parents; and two sisters, Margaret Klassen and Luty Lee White. He was a member of Beta Theta Pi Fraternity. Karl was a salesman. Mr. Enns worked at Chief Pontiac, and Quality Pontiac and was also a broker in the real estate business, until he retired in 1969. He loved sports and participated in them in the Inman schools and at Kansas State University in Manhattan, Kansas. Mr. Enns was an avid Lobo fan for 50 years. Cremation has taken place and a family memorial service will be held at a later date. Should friends desire, memorial contributions may be made to Sandia Hospice, 4775 Indian School Rd.
